Manulife (Manufacturers Life Insurance)’s FormFactor FORM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$1.4M Sell
40,583
-2,036
-5% -$70.1K ﹤0.01% 1664
2025
Q1
$1.21M Sell
42,619
-1,204
-3% -$34.1K ﹤0.01% 1727
2024
Q4
$1.93M Sell
43,823
-1,027
-2% -$45.2K ﹤0.01% 1578
2024
Q3
$2.06M Buy
44,850
+1,457
+3% +$67K ﹤0.01% 1536
2024
Q2
$2.63M Buy
43,393
+1,649
+4% +$99.8K ﹤0.01% 1415
2024
Q1
$1.9M Buy
41,744
+3,672
+10% +$168K ﹤0.01% 1536
2023
Q4
$1.59M Sell
38,072
-1,245
-3% -$51.9K ﹤0.01% 1560
2023
Q3
$1.37M Buy
39,317
+7,986
+25% +$279K ﹤0.01% 1565
2023
Q2
$1.07M Buy
31,331
+213
+0.7% +$7.29K ﹤0.01% 1615
2023
Q1
$991K Buy
31,118
+119
+0.4% +$3.79K ﹤0.01% 1644
2022
Q4
$689K Sell
30,999
-13,537
-30% -$301K ﹤0.01% 1800
2022
Q3
$1.12M Sell
44,536
-4,022
-8% -$101K ﹤0.01% 1560
2022
Q2
$1.88M Sell
48,558
-560,683
-92% -$21.7M ﹤0.01% 1438
2022
Q1
$25.6M Sell
609,241
-26,530
-4% -$1.12M 0.02% 581
2021
Q4
$29.1K Sell
635,771
-392
-0.1% -$18 0.02% 522
2021
Q3
$23.7M Buy
636,163
+592,611
+1,361% +$22.1M 0.02% 584
2021
Q2
$1.59M Buy
43,552
+464
+1% +$16.9K ﹤0.01% 1713
2021
Q1
$1.94M Sell
43,088
-2,790
-6% -$126K ﹤0.01% 1553
2020
Q4
$1.97M Buy
45,878
+1,431
+3% +$61.6K ﹤0.01% 1540
2020
Q3
$1.11M Sell
44,447
-622
-1% -$15.5K ﹤0.01% 1611
2020
Q2
$1.27M Sell
45,069
-2,395
-5% -$67.3K ﹤0.01% 1534
2020
Q1
$954K Buy
47,464
+3,257
+7% +$65.5K ﹤0.01% 1539
2019
Q4
$1.15M Sell
44,207
-1,184
-3% -$30.7K ﹤0.01% 1607
2019
Q3
$839K Sell
45,391
-626
-1% -$11.6K ﹤0.01% 1736
2019
Q2
$721K Sell
46,017
-2,111
-4% -$33.1K ﹤0.01% 1831
2019
Q1
$774K Buy
48,128
+3,135
+7% +$50.4K ﹤0.01% 1833
2018
Q4
$634K Sell
44,993
-489,464
-92% -$6.9M ﹤0.01% 1834
2018
Q3
$7.35M Sell
534,457
-84,600
-14% -$1.16M 0.01% 1054
2018
Q2
$8.23M Buy
619,057
+565,176
+1,049% +$7.52M 0.01% 999
2018
Q1
$735K Sell
53,881
-955
-2% -$13K ﹤0.01% 2049
2017
Q4
$859K Sell
54,836
-150
-0.3% -$2.35K ﹤0.01% 1949
2017
Q3
$927K Sell
54,986
-1,374
-2% -$23.2K ﹤0.01% 1838
2017
Q2
$699K Buy
56,360
+2,731
+5% +$33.9K ﹤0.01% 2044
2017
Q1
$636K Buy
53,629
+6,576
+14% +$78K ﹤0.01% 2020
2016
Q4
$527K Sell
47,053
-436
-0.9% -$4.88K ﹤0.01% 2059
2016
Q3
$516K Sell
47,489
-188
-0.4% -$2.04K ﹤0.01% 2069
2016
Q2
$429K Buy
47,677
+9,086
+24% +$81.8K ﹤0.01% 2141
2016
Q1
$281K Buy
38,591
+186
+0.5% +$1.35K ﹤0.01% 2357
2015
Q4
$346 Hold
38,405
﹤0.01% 2269
2015
Q3
$260 Buy
38,405
+1,597
+4% +$11 ﹤0.01% 2440
2015
Q2
$339 Sell
36,808
-951
-3% -$9 ﹤0.01% 2405
2015
Q1
$335 Buy
37,759
+2,855
+8% +$25 ﹤0.01% 2357
2014
Q4
$300 Sell
34,904
-914
-3% -$8 ﹤0.01% 2347
2014
Q3
$257 Sell
35,818
-232
-0.6% -$2 ﹤0.01% 2455
2014
Q2
$300K Sell
36,050
-5,593
-13% -$46.5K ﹤0.01% 2419
2014
Q1
$267 Sell
41,643
-49
-0.1% ﹤0.01% 2516
2013
Q4
$251 Buy
41,692
+1,908
+5% +$11 ﹤0.01% 2548
2013
Q3
$273 Buy
39,784
+561
+1% +$4 ﹤0.01% 2419
2013
Q2
$265K Buy
+39,223
New +$265K ﹤0.01% 2348